Black & white photo of Frederick Henry Hedge.The title of an old rock song by The Clash provides the inspiration for a sermon on Bangor’s most famous minister, Frederic Henry Hedge. As many of you probably know Hedge was one of the early leaders of the Transcendentalists, and their famous discussion group was given the name Hedge’s Club. He went to Bangor in 1835 with some misgivings. It was even said he was exiled there, but then he stayed for fifteen years. Hedge was often caught in the middle of conflicts over church and theology and where he was going to call home. Decisions about coming, staying and going are never easy. Can Hedge’s life help us with these conflicts?

Every Sunday, we share half of our undesignated plate offerings with an organization that works toward our UU values. In March, half of the undesignated funds in the plate will go to MUUSAN. The Maine Unitarian Universalist State Advocacy Network is a statewide advocacy and public policy network anchored in our Unitarian Universalist faith and animated by its principles. This legislative ministry links Maine’s 22 Unitarian Universalist congregations to promote just, humane laws and policies in keeping with our UUA Seven Principles.
